    Staying at the Polynesian,can I make dining reservations for my family( 5 people) but also include friends(3) that we would like to dine with one night in Epcot that aren't staying at the Polynesian?Can I make a reservation for 8 people 180 days out?

    Hi Linda,

    Or, perhaps I should say, "Aloha!" You're going to LOVE staying at Disney's Polynesian Village Resort. Not only is the location perfect, being right on the monorail, but the theming is amazing and it's an absolutely gorgeous Resort hotel!

    A Walt Disney World Resort vacation is magical anytime, but when you're able to enjoy special moments with family AND friends, you are sure to make memories to last a lifetime! I'm happy to let you know that you'll be able to make an advanced dining reservation for eight people when your booking window opens even if there are only five people staying in your room, and your friends will be able to join you for dinner! Epcot has so many delicious dining options; have fun deciding which restaurant is best for you!
